Ticket: Config drift on the Haldane garage occupancy feed. The Ostermill node is publishing counts every 5s while the other three garages publish every 15s, which skews the aggregation window downstream in Lotgrid. Someone hot-patched the interval during the holiday surge and never reverted. Please review the diff and restore parity across all nodes. The intended baseline configuration is as follows.

settings of kahip-hafop:
ralix:
  log_level: warn
  metrics_host: metrics.ralix.zemvarsys.internal
  pin: 8273
  pool_size: 8

UserSplit Cutover Drift: the extracted account service and the legacy Marigold monolith user module are reporting divergent record counts during dual-write. This fires when drift exceeds 0.5% over 15 minutes. New team members should not replay writes manually. Reconciliation steps and the rollback procedure are documented on the internal page.

wiki page, tajog-fafog: https://gitlab.paliqsys.corp/dash/display/job/853dd6fcbf54

Changed defaults in Splitfork, our assignment service. Bucketing now uses sticky hashing per account instead of per session, and the holdout slice grew from 2% to 5%. Callers relying on session-level reassignment must opt in explicitly. Review the diff against the new baseline; the updated default configuration is listed below.

config for tagep-kajof:
[casir]
port = 6379
region = south-1
host = casir.paliqdyn.example
team = tamax
timeout_ms = 250
retries = 2